Great Danes: A Brief Overview

Great Danes, also known as Deutsche Dogge, are one of the largest dog breeds in the world. They can weigh up to 200 pounds and stand up to 32 inches tall at the shoulder. Great Danes are believed to have originated in Germany, where they were bred to hunt wild boar. Today, they are more commonly kept as companion animals due to their loyal and affectionate nature.

The Temperament of Great Danes

Despite their imposing size, Great Danes are known for being gentle, friendly, and affectionate dogs. They are loyal to their owners and are generally good with children and other pets. Great Danes are also intelligent and easy to train, making them popular as service dogs and therapy dogs.

Do Great Danes Enjoy Physical Affection?

Yes, Great Danes do enjoy physical affection, including cuddling with their owners. They are affectionate dogs that crave attention and love to be close to their owners. Many Great Danes will seek out physical contact, such as sitting on their owner’s lap or leaning against them.

Cuddling: A Natural Instinct for Great Danes

Cuddling is a natural instinct for Great Danes. Like many other dog breeds, Great Danes are pack animals and enjoy being close to their family members. Cuddling provides a sense of security and comfort to these gentle giants.

Benefits of Cuddling with Great Danes

Cuddling with Great Danes has many benefits for both the owner and the dog. It helps to strengthen the bond between the two and can reduce stress and anxiety in both. Cuddling can also lower blood pressure and promote relaxation.

How to Initiate Cuddling with Great Danes

To initiate cuddling with your Great Dane, start by sitting or lying down on the floor next to them. Gently stroke their fur and speak to them in a soft, soothing voice. Many Great Danes will naturally gravitate towards their owners and cuddle up next to them.

Signs That Your Great Dane Wants to Cuddle

Some signs that your Great Dane wants to cuddle include leaning against you, resting their head on your lap, or lying down next to you. They may also nudge you with their nose or paw at you to get your attention.

Cuddling Etiquette for Great Dane Owners

When cuddling with your Great Dane, it is important to be gentle and respectful of their size. Avoid squeezing or putting pressure on them, as this can cause discomfort or even injury. It is also important to be aware of any signs of discomfort or anxiety in your dog and to stop cuddling if they appear uncomfortable.

Common Misconceptions About Cuddling with Great Danes

One common misconception about Great Danes is that they are too large to cuddle comfortably. However, many Great Danes enjoy cuddling and will happily snuggle up with their owners. Another misconception is that Great Danes are not affectionate dogs, but this could not be further from the truth.
